Frames made of sturdy materials

The sturdy frames of 3 wheeler buggy wheeler buggies and pushchairs make them durable and long-lasting. They are also more stable than four-wheeled pushchairs, meaning your baby or toddler can relax during a long walk or go out with you. You can pick from a range of 3 wheeler prams that are suitable for infants all the way to toddlers. No matter if you opt for one 3 wheel pushchair or a double buggy 3 wheels pushchair these models will provide multiple recline positions as your child develops and will come with fantastic storage solutions too.

All-terrain pushchairs are an excellent choice for outdoor enthusiasts and those who wish to take their family on sandy or muddy excursions. They are designed with extra-large wheels, both in the front and back, and they come with suspension systems that ensure your little one has a pleasant ride. They are often also designed with extra features like the handbrake and the adjustable handlebars to provide extra comfort and convenience.

Joggers and strollers are two other popular types of 3 wheeler pushchairs. Strollers have a smaller, lighter frame that allows them to be more maneuverable in urban areas. They can be folded easily and put in the trunk of your car for a quick drive to the shops or through the park. Joggers are designed for active parents and designed to let you jog or even run with your child. They could have larger and wider wheels to allow them to handle uneven surfaces. They could also come with a seat and harness adjustment for your child's comfort and security.

3 wheel stroller with bassinet wheeler buggies have the benefit of being lightweight and compact when folded, which makes them an ideal choice for those who have busy lives. They are less likely to fall over than buggies with four wheels, and can be pushed by one hand when needed. They don't have the same amount of storage as an ordinary buggy or stroller due their triangular frame. It's a good idea to think about a four-wheeled pushchair if you frequently go shopping or have to navigate narrow aisles or crowded city streets regularly.

Easy to maneuver

Typically, they are designed with two larger wheels at the back and a smaller wheel in front three-wheel pushchairs can maneuver in a manner that 4-wheeled models simply cannot. They are great for shopping and busy streets where you need to turn and make turns quickly and easily. They are also great for off-road adventures because the single wheel in the front allows them to handle bumps and gravel effortlessly.

When you choose a 3 wheeler pushchair, make sure that it has tyres with air filled and puncture-proof materials. This will help keep the buggy in good condition, making it easier for you and your baby to move around on any terrain. It will also help keep the weight distribution evenly distributed in the pushchair, so that it doesn't overturn too easily.

Another important factor to consider when selecting a 3 wheeler pushchair is whether it will be suitable for newborns. Find a model with an auto-reclining seat that can accommodate a carrycot or car seat from birth. It is also important to determine if it folds and unfolds without effort, since this can be extremely helpful when you're on the go.

Make sure your buggy is equipped with a reversible handgrip. This allows you to alter the direction the handle is facing in accordance with your preferences. This can be particularly useful if you're going to be using it on grass, cobbles or dirt tracks that aren't appropriate to regular pushchairs.

A 3-wheeler is also an ideal choice if you're looking for an infant stroller to take you and your baby out for jogging. It'll typically come with a set of XL air-filled wheels and suspension, which means it can cope with any surface. Some models come with a lockable rotating front wheel that is perfect for running on difficult surfaces. Some jogging strollers can be used for infants when used in conjunction with a car seat or carrycot that is compatible. However, you must wait until your child is at least six or nine months old before running with them.

Easy to clean

Cleaning your pushchair regularly is important to prevent staining, dirt and mold. This will keep it looking and functioning like new for as long as is possible. Keep your pushchair in good condition by doing a quick clean every week and a thorough clean once a monthly.

Begin by assessing the extent of dirt, mud, and mould to determine any areas that require attention. Use a soft-bristled toothbrush to lift dry mud and debris from fabric surfaces like the seat and basket will make it much easier to clean. Vacuum or dust the entire stroller, including all crevices and nooks in which food crumbs, dust and other debris build up. You can also use a small, fabric brush or an (old!) brush to get into more difficult-to-reach corners and wrinkles.

The wheels of your stroller, no matter if they're made of rubber or plastic are more soiled than other areas since they are directly in contact with the floor. It's best to start with the wheels. A scourer may be helpful in removing stubborn marks, but you should always try to avoid scratching the surface of the frame since this could lead to corrosion.

Then, wash the wheels thoroughly with clean water and allow them to dry completely before reattaching the wheels to the frame of the chassis. Be sure to consult your user's manual to see if the manufacturer recommends lubricating the wheel bearings on a regular basis.

The problem of mould is a issue for a lot of parents because it can not only look unsightly, but it can release spores that can be harmful to your child. It is important to eliminate mould as soon you see it, using a mould removal product such as white vinegar. This will help break down bacteria and remove the stain from the fabric, leaving the surface spotless. If you're fortunate the product you choose to remove mould will also leave your pushchair clean and fresh!

Fantastic storage

All-terrain pushchairs are a fantastic choice for parents who enjoy going out with their children and want to be able to navigate rough terrain. They typically have large rear wheels as well as excellent suspension, which makes them ideal for off-road usage as well as navigating pavements and paths that are paved.

These kinds of pushchairs tend to have lots of great storage options, including spacious baskets and pockets on the hood. They're usually designed to be easy to fold, with certain models being able to fold with one hand.

It's important to be aware that these pushchairs may be slightly larger than standard buggies. This could mean that they're not suitable for small vehicles or narrow aisles for shopping. When folded, they're often heavy and heavy. This is something you should consider if you have to lift it up steps or to fit it into the boot of your car.

MFM reviewer Kath took the iCandy Core through its paces and found that it was capable "to navigate through cobbles, grass, and dirt tracks effortlessly and easily traverse over kerbs and up hills". With its 16" rear wheels and a lockable front wheel the Core can be used as a stroller once your child is old enough. The tyres have a foam-filled design, which is never flat, so you only need fill them up every now and then. They also come with built-in suspension to make sure your child is comfortable ride.

Another excellent option is the Mountain Buggy Ridge, which comes with a variety of brilliant features that make it an ideal all-terrain stroller from birth. It's compatible with a carrycot and has a seat that can be positioned flat, and can be used from birth. You can also develop with your child using the infant or toddler carriers. It features a superb suspension system, big air-filled tires that can be pumped with the press of a single button and a water-resistant, durable fabric. an easy-to-use brake with one hand.
